Этот узел объединяет две модели ИИ на основе блоков с точным контролем над различными компонентами модели. Он позволяет смешивать модели, регулируя веса интерполяции для отдельных участков, включая позиционные частоты, слои внедрения и отдельные блоки трансформера. Процесс объединения комбинирует архитектуры и параметры обеих входных моделей в соответствии с заданными значениями весов.

## Входные параметры

| Параметр | Описание | Тип данных | Обязательный | Диапазон |
| --- | --- | --- | --- | --- |
| `модель1` | Первая модель для объединения | MODEL | Да | - |
| `модель2` | Вторая модель для объединения | MODEL | Да | - |
| `pos_frequencies.` | Вес интерполяции позиционных частот (по умолчанию: 1.0) | FLOAT | Да | 0.0 - 1.0 |
| `t_embedder.` | Вес интерполяции временного эмбеддера (по умолчанию: 1.0) | FLOAT | Да | 0.0 - 1.0 |
| `t5_y_embedder.` | Вес интерполяции T5-Y эмбеддера (по умолчанию: 1.0) | FLOAT | Да | 0.0 - 1.0 |
| `t5_yproj.` | Вес интерполяции проекции T5-Y (по умолчанию: 1.0) | FLOAT | Да | 0.0 - 1.0 |
| `blocks.0.` | Вес интерполяции блока 0 (по умолчанию: 1.0) | FLOAT | Да | 0.0 - 1.0 |
| `blocks.1.` | Вес интерполяции блока 1 (по умолчанию: 1.0) | FLOAT | Да | 0.0 - 1.0 |
| `blocks.2.` | Вес интерполяции блока 2 (по умолчанию: 1.0) | FLOAT | Да | 0.0 - 1.0 |
| `blocks.3.` | Вес интерполяции блока 3 (по умолчанию: 1.0) | FLOAT | Да | 0.0 - 1.0 |
| `blocks.4.` | Вес интерполяции блока 4 (по умолчанию: 1.0) | FLOAT | Да | 0.0 - 1.0 |
| `blocks.5.` | Вес интерполяции блока 5 (по умолчанию: 1.0) | FLOAT | Да | 0.0 - 1.0 |
| `blocks.6.` | Вес интерполяции блока 6 (по умолчанию: 1.0) | FLOAT | Да | 0.0 - 1.0 |
| `blocks.7.` | Вес интерполяции блока 7 (по умолчанию: 1.0) | FLOAT | Да | 0.0 - 1.0 |
| `blocks.8.` | Вес интерполяции блока 8 (по умолчанию: 1.0) | FLOAT | Да | 0.0 - 1.0 |
| `blocks.9.` | Вес интерполяции блока 9 (по умолчанию: 1.0) | FLOAT | Да | 0.0 - 1.0 |
| `blocks.10.` | Вес интерполяции блока 10 (по умолчанию: 1.0) | FLOAT | Да | 0.0 - 1.0 |
| `blocks.11.` | Вес интерполяции блока 11 (по умолчанию: 1.0) | FLOAT | Да | 0.0 - 1.0 |
| `blocks.12.` | Вес интерполяции блока 12 (по умолчанию: 1.0) | FLOAT | Да | 0.0 - 1.0 |
| `blocks.13.` | Вес интерполяции блока 13 (по умолчанию: 1.0) | FLOAT | Да | 0.0 - 1.0 |
| `blocks.14.` | Вес интерполяции блока 14 (по умолчанию: 1.0) | FLOAT | Да | 0.0 - 1.0 |
| `blocks.15.` | Вес интерполяции блока 15 (по умолчанию: 1.0) | FLOAT | Да | 0.0 - 1.0 |
| `blocks.16.` | Вес интерполяции блока 16 (по умолчанию: 1.0) | FLOAT | Да | 0.0 - 1.0 |
| `blocks.17.` | Вес интерполяции блока 17 (по умолчанию: 1.0) | FLOAT | Да | 0.0 - 1.0 |
| `blocks.18.` | Вес интерполяции блока 18 (по умолчанию: 1.0) | FLOAT | Да | 0.0 - 1.0 |
| `blocks.19.` | Вес интерполяции блока 19 (по умолчанию: 1.0) | FLOAT | Да | 0.0 - 1.0 |
| `blocks.20.` | Вес интерполяции блока 20 (по умолчанию: 1.0) | FLOAT | Да | 0.0 - 1.0 |
| `blocks.21.` | Вес интерполяции блока 21 (по умолчанию: 1.0) | FLOAT | Да | 0.0 - 1.0 |
| `blocks.22.` | Вес интерполяции блока 22 (по умолчанию: 1.0) | FLOAT | Да | 0.0 - 1.0 |
| `blocks.23.` | Вес интерполяции блока 23 (по умолчанию: 1.0) | FLOAT | Да | 0.0 - 1.0 |
| `blocks.24.` | Вес интерполяции блока 24 (по умолчанию: 1.0) | FLOAT | Да | 0.0 - 1.0 |
| `blocks.25.` | Вес интерполяции блока 25 (по умолчанию: 1.0) | FLOAT | Да | 0.0 - 1.0 |
| `blocks.26.` | Вес интерполяции блока 26 (по умолчанию: 1.0) | FLOAT | Да | 0.0 - 1.0 |
| `blocks.27.` | Вес интерполяции блока 27 (по умолчанию: 1.0) | FLOAT | Да | 0.0 - 1.0 |
| `blocks.28.` | Вес интерполяции блока 28 (по умолчанию: 1.0) | FLOAT | Да | 0.0 - 1.0 |
| `blocks.29.` | Вес интерполяции блока 29 (по умолчанию: 1.0) | FLOAT | Да | 0.0 - 1.0 |
| `blocks.30.` | Вес интерполяции блока 30 (по умолчанию: 1.0) | FLOAT | Да | 0.0 - 1.0 |
| `blocks.31.` | Вес интерполяции блока 31 (по умолчанию: 1.0) | FLOAT | Да | 0.0 - 1.0 |
| `blocks.32.` | Вес интерполяции блока 32 (по умолчанию: 1.0) | FLOAT | Да | 0.0 - 1.0 |
| `blocks.33.` | Вес интерполяции блока 33 (по умолчанию: 1.0) | FLOAT | Да | 0.0 - 1.0 |
| `blocks.34.` | Вес интерполяции блока 34 (по умолчанию: 1.0) | FLOAT | Да | 0.0 - 1.0 |
| `blocks.35.` | Вес интерполяции блока 35 (по умолчанию: 1.0) | FLOAT | Да | 0.0 - 1.0 |
| `blocks.36.` | Вес интерполяции блока 36 (по умолчанию: 1.0) | FLOAT | Да | 0.0 - 1.0 |
| `blocks.37.` | Вес интерполяции блока 37 (по умолчанию: 1.0) | FLOAT | Да | 0.0 - 1.0 |
| `blocks.38.` | Вес интерполяции блока 38 (по умолчанию: 1.0) | FLOAT | Да | 0.0 - 1.0 |
| `blocks.39.` | Вес интерполяции блока 39 (по умолчанию: 1.0) | FLOAT | Да | 0.0 - 1.0 |
| `blocks.40.` | Вес интерполяции блока 40 (по умолчанию: 1.0) | FLOAT | Да | 0.0 - 1.0 |
| `blocks.41.` | Вес интерполяции блока 41 (по умолчанию: 1.0) | FLOAT | Да | 0.0 - 1.0 |
| `blocks.42.` | Вес интерполяции блока 42 (по умолчанию: 1.0) | FLOAT | Да | 0.0 - 1.0 |
| `blocks.43.` | Вес интерполяции блока 43 (по умолчанию: 1.0) | FLOAT | Да | 0.0 - 1.0 |
| `blocks.44.` | Вес интерполяции блока 44 (по умолчанию: 1.0) | FLOAT | Да | 0.0 - 1.0 |
| `blocks.45.` | Вес интерполяции блока 45 (по умолчанию: 1.0) | FLOAT | Да | 0.0 - 1.0 |
| `blocks.46.` | Вес интерполяции блока 46 (по умолчанию: 1.0) | FLOAT | Да | 0.0 - 1.0 |
| `blocks.47.` | Вес интерполяции блока 47 (по умолчанию: 1.0) | FLOAT | Да | 0.0 - 1.0 |
| `final_layer.` | Вес интерполяции финального слоя (по умолчанию: 1.0) | FLOAT | Да | 0.0 - 1.0 |

## Выходные параметры

| Имя выхода | Описание | Тип данных |
| --- | --- | --- |
| `model` | Объединённая модель, сочетающая характеристики обеих входных моделей в соответствии с заданными весами | MODEL |

> Эта документация была создана с помощью ИИ. Если вы обнаружите ошибки или у вас есть предложения по улучшению, пожалуйста, внесите свой вклад! [Редактировать на GitHub](https://github.com/Comfy-Org/embedded-docs/blob/main/comfyui_embedded_docs/docs/ModelMergeMochiPreview/ru.md)

---
**Source fingerprint (SHA-256):** `aebf536f3f89ca8c81141ac871b1b612082c3bd38a29984168b05eccf0cb57e3`
